With this version of NHL Slapshot you get to use a special hockey stick that is an add-on to the game. This device is a breeze to put together. You don’t even have to watch the little video clip at the beginning of the game that shows you how the parts snap into place; you can figure it out on your own.
There is an annoying problem with the use of the hockey sticks that are designed to accompany these video games. Whenever you need to navigate among the different Wii menus you have to detach the Wii Remote from the holder first. For those game enthusiasts who already have additional Wii controllers this will not present a problem at all. If there is only one Wii hand held controller in your home this annoyance can quickly turn into a major aggravation.

NHL Slapshot is one of the video games that features a variety of playing modes. With the Career mode you can begin as a Pee Wee player and then move on to Bantam leagues. Next you will need to master the Junior league before you qualify for an online career as a professional NHL player. This is the longest style of playing mode and it may be too time consuming to hold the interest of kids who are younger than 10-12. The Play Now option and the mini-games both teach players what to do and where to go while keeping the game fast paced and interesting. These modes of play are just for a single player and there are even arrows that appear on the screen that will direct you to the correct playing position.
